Current DMX Net Worth and Public Financial Status

As of the most recent public reporting, DMX's net worth is widely cited in the low single-digit millions or near zero, reflecting decades of earnings offset by heavy debts and legal costs. Creditors, the IRS, and courts have repeatedly placed liens on his assets, and his estate remains under probate administration after his April 2021 death, with ongoing efforts to settle liabilities and distribute any remaining value to heirs and claimants Forbes.

Public filings and news reports describe a cycle of high earnings from albums, tours, and film roles that were largely consumed by taxes, legal fees, and personal spending, leaving little or no liquid wealth at the time of his death and during the years of severe financial distress that preceded it.

Major Income Sources, Earnings, and Career Milestones

DMX rose to fame in the late 1990s with albums such as "It's Dark and Hell Is Hot" and "Flesh of My Flesh, Blood of My Blood," which sold millions of copies and generated substantial royalties, touring revenue, and licensing income across streaming platforms and physical sales RIAA.

Beyond music, he earned from starring roles in films like "Belly," "Romeo Must Die," and "Exit Wounds," as well as from reality TV appearances and endorsement deals, though inconsistent management, tax issues, and legal disputes limited his ability to convert those opportunities into long-term wealth.

DMX faced multiple tax-evasion cases, bankruptcy filings, and lawsuits over unpaid debts, with the IRS and state authorities claiming significant unpaid taxes from earnings in the late 1990s and early 2000s, and courts ordering wage garnishments and asset seizures during his later career SEC.

After his death, his estate entered probate to resolve outstanding creditor claims, tax obligations, and disputes among heirs, with executors tasked with inventorying assets such as royalties, real estate, and personal property while negotiating settlements and distributing any remaining value according to court oversight and state law CourtListener.
